I spent the day (at home in Luang Prabang, north Laos), putting up some new antennas for my ham radio station. This basically requires me to throw fishing line attached to fishing lead weights high over the palm trees in my garden, attach the line to a string and pull the string up, then attach the end of the string to the end of my wire antenna and pull that up.
Sounds straightforward? Typically, I throw the lead weight in the wrong direction and it gets stuck in a tree and has to be 'abandoned'. Or my weight turns into a deadly missile and sails over into the adjacent road where motorcyclists past regularly. Even if I get the weight over the right tree, the fishing line can snag and break, or I get the lead weight heading at speed towards my face as it riccochets back when I pull the line, or I get bitten by 100 red ants on the trees etc etc.
Finally, after completing this task in the monsoon rain and retreating back inside the house and eagerly plugging in my radio, I typically find reception/transmission is no better than before, and it's time to think of a different antenna design.
I've been a radio ham for yonks, and it is both an enjoyable AND a very frustrating hobby
